Nuveen Equity Long/Short Fund (NELCX) is a mutual fund managed by Nuveen Fund Advisors, LLC that seeks long-term capital appreciation with low correlation to the U.S. equity market by establishing long and short positions in a diversified portfolio of primarily large-capitalization and mid-capitalization equity securities of U.S. companies. The fund invests substantially in securities included in the Russell 1000 Index at the time positions are taken, employing rigorous fundamental research complemented by quantitative analysis to identify opportunities across diversified sectors; it offers multiple share classes including Class A (NELAX), Class C (NELCX), Class I (NELIX), and others, targeting institutional and retail investors seeking alternative equity strategies. In recent developments, Nuveen acquired Brooklyn Investment Group in June 2025, expanding its direct indexing capabilities with tax-advantaged long/short portfolios and multi-asset products following a 2023 strategic partnership and minority stake investment.
